CHAPTER ONE: A Concrete Jungle Buzzes with Life
The city, with its relentless pace and towering structures, might seem like an unlikely haven for the delicate dance of pollination. Yet, beneath the veneer of concrete and glass, a vibrant and complex world of bees thrives. This chapter delves into the fascinating ways these industrious insects have adapted to urban environments, transforming what many perceive as a barren landscape into a bustling hub of life. Far from being ecological deserts, cities often present a surprising array of resources that allow bees to not only survive but, in many cases, flourish.
One might picture rolling fields of wildflowers when contemplating bee habitats, but the urban landscape, in its own idiosyncratic way, offers a diverse buffet. Parks, community gardens, residential yards, and even the seemingly insignificant green strips along sidewalks provide a patchwork of floral resources. This varied planting, often incorporating a mix of native and exotic species, can sometimes offer a more consistent and prolonged availability of nectar and pollen compared to monoculture-dominated rural areas. Think of a city as a giant, unplanned botanical garden, where diverse human populations have inadvertently created a rich tapestry of flowering plants from around the globe.
However, urban living isn't without its unique challenges for bees. One of the most obvious hurdles is the sheer lack of continuous natural habitat. Buildings, roads, and other impervious surfaces fragment green spaces, making it harder for bees to travel safely between foraging grounds and nesting sites. This habitat loss and fragmentation can lead to a decline in pollinator species, with some studies showing a significant drop in diversity in more urbanized areas. Specialist bees, for instance, which rely on pollen from a specific group of closely related native plants, can struggle when their preferred flora is displaced by urban development.
Despite these challenges, many bee species demonstrate remarkable adaptability. Generalist bees, those less particular about their floral menu, often thrive in urban gardens precisely because they can forage on a wide variety of flowering plants. This adaptability extends to nesting habits as well. While many bee species are ground-nesters, needing undisturbed soil to lay their eggs, some urban bees have found ingenious alternatives. Cavity-nesting bees, for example, readily utilize hollow plant stems or holes in wood left by wood-boring beetles, resources that can be surprisingly abundant in city parks and gardens.
The presence of urban green spaces, even small ones, plays a crucial role in supporting these resilient populations. Parks, gardens, and residential yards act as vital habitats, providing essential foraging and nesting resources. These green patches can also function as "stepping-stone" habitats, enhancing connectivity and allowing bees to move more easily through the urban maze. A study in Toronto, for example, found that green roofs on low to mid-rise buildings supported higher levels of bee and wasp diversity. Even humble windowsill flower boxes and living walls contribute to this network, offering easily accessible nectar and pollen resources.
Beyond honeybees, which are often the focus of urban beekeeping efforts, cities host a surprising diversity of native bee species. These include various species of bumblebees, known for their fuzzy bodies and distinctive buzz, and solitary bees like mason bees and leaf-cutter bees. Mining bees, which create their nests in the ground, can even be found in urban and suburban lawns. This rich tapestry of bee life contributes significantly to urban biodiversity and the overall health of city ecosystems.

One of the often-overlooked advantages of urban environments for bees is the extended flowering season. Due to the diverse range of planted species and often warmer microclimates, cities can offer floral resources for a longer period compared to rural areas, providing a continuous food supply for bees. This prolonged availability can be particularly beneficial for generalist bee species that can adapt their foraging strategies. The variety of plants, both native and ornamental, contributes to this extended bloom, creating a sequential feast for pollinators from early spring to late autumn.
However, the types of plants chosen for urban green spaces matter greatly. While exotic and ornamental plants can provide nectar and pollen, native plants are generally more beneficial as they have co-evolved with local bee species and often offer the specific nutritional resources that native bees require. A focus on increasing floral abundance and diversity, particularly with native species, is consistently recommended for making cities more bee-friendly. This strategic planting can significantly enhance pollinator visitation rates within urban habitats.
The concept of "wild" or unmanaged spaces within cities also holds unexpected value. Patches of wild vegetation, roadside verges, and even neglected vacant lots can become crucial habitats for bees, supporting a surprising diversity of species. These seemingly unruly areas often provide a mix of flowering plants and undisturbed ground that are ideal for various bee nesting and foraging needs. Rethinking our aesthetic preferences for manicured lawns and embracing a bit more wildness in our urban landscapes can have a profound positive impact on bee populations.

The diversity of bee species found in cities often includes various types of bumblebees, such as the Buff-tailed Bumblebee and the Tree Bumblebee, which can be observed in gardens and weed-filled yards. Sweat bees, with their often metallic green bodies, and carpenter bees are also common urban residents. The presence of such a wide range of bee types underscores the adaptability of these insects and the varied resources that cities can offer. Understanding these different species and their specific needs is a crucial step in effective urban bee conservation.
Furthermore, urban environments often have unique microclimates that can benefit bees. The urban heat island effect, where cities are significantly warmer than surrounding rural areas, can sometimes extend the active season for bees, allowing them to forage for longer periods. While extreme heat can be detrimental, a slightly warmer environment can be advantageous. Green roofs and tree canopies can help to mitigate excessive heat, creating more comfortable conditions for both bees and humans.
The role of trees in urban bee life is also significant. Trees provide not only floral resources but also potential nesting sites for certain species. Their presence contributes to a more complex and diverse urban ecosystem, offering shelter and shade in addition to food. As vertical elements in the urban landscape, trees can connect different levels of foraging and nesting opportunities, acting as essential components of bee-friendly cities.
Despite the prevailing narrative of bee decline, cities offer a glimmer of hope. Research indicates that urban areas can, in some instances, support a higher diversity and abundance of bees compared to certain agricultural landscapes, particularly those dominated by monocultures. This is largely due to the greater diversity of flowering plants and nesting locations found within urban green spaces.
